About PDF Format
PDF (Portable Document Format) is a universal document format created by Adobe. It preserves formatting, fonts, and layout across all devices and operating systems, making it the standard for official documents, contracts, and publications.
About HEIC Format
HEIC (High Efficiency Image Container) is Apple's default photo format using HEVC compression. It produces files roughly half the size of JPEG at similar quality. Native to iOS and macOS, with growing cross-platform support.
